Ministry of Road Transport & Highways PARIVARTAN Scheme gains momentum: 1,300+ beneficiaries registered, 42 Banks/NBFCs and 15 auto OEMs onboarded across Delhi-NCR Posted On: 28 AUG 2026 6:58PM by PIB Delhi The Union Cabinet, on 3rd June 2026, approved the PARIVARTAN (Programme for Accelerated Renewal and Incentivization of Vehicle Assets for Reducing Transport Air Pollution and Network Emissions) Scheme, to replace over 2 lakh trucks and buses conforming to Bharat Stage (BS)-IV or prior emission norms, registered in the National Capital Territory of Delhi and the NCR districts of Haryana, Rajasthan and Uttar Pradesh, with BS-VI or stricter norm compliant or electric vehicles. The Scheme is being funded through the National Capital Region Planning Board (NCRPB) under the Ministry of Housing and Urban Affairs (MoHUA) and is being implemented by the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ways (MoRTH). The Scheme has a total financial outlay of ₹9,585 crore, including ₹5,041 crore in budgetary support from the Central Government. Eligible beneficiaries purchasing new BS-VI or stricter norm compliant diesel or CNG vehicles, or electric vehicles, are entitled to a package of incentives comprising: 5% interest savings on eligible vehicle loans for 5 years; 100% Road Tax Waiver for a period of 10 years and a full waiver on registration fees (the States of Delhi, Haryana, Rajasthan and Uttar Pradesh have already issued notifications in this regard); at least 8% discount on ex-showroom price from participating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s); and monthly fuel vouchers ranging from ₹1,200 to ₹4,800, depending on vehicle category, for a period of five years for buyers of BS-VI diesel or CNG vehicles, or a one-time incentive ranging from ₹64,000 to ₹2.56 lakh for buyers of electric vehicles. The Scheme was launched on 14th July 2026. As on 27th Aug 2026, 1,300+ beneficiaries have registered on the PARIVARTAN Portal. To extend financing support, 42 banks and non-banking financial companies (NBFCs) have been onboarded to provide interest subvention on vehicle loans. On the industry side, Memoranda of Understanding (MoUs) have been signed with 15 auto OEMs to extend the discount to eligible beneficiaries. A multi-pronged awareness campaign is being undertaken to reach eligible vehicle owners across Delhi- NCR regarding the benefits and registration process under the Scheme. The campaign spans print, electronic and digital media, and outdoor publicity at fuel stations, transport nagars, toll plazas and Regional Transport Offices (RTOs) across Delhi-NCR, with the aim of driving wider beneficiary registration and participation under the Scheme.Sh.
